What does Sisley mean?

Offbeat and Contemporary Sisley is originated from Latin is used especially in English bestowed upon girls, Sisley means "Dim Sighted, Blind One, Sixth or Similar to Cecilia". Sisley is variant of prevalent and virtuous Cecilia.

Also Cecilia is form of Caecilia in Nordic language. Far-out and Fresh Cecilia's origin is Latin, meaning of Cecilia is "Dim Sighted, Sixth and Blind One".
